How to reach Reno
Reaching Reno from the UK is straightforward and convenient, with average flight times of approximately 10 to 12 hours depending on your departure city. From London, expect one or more layovers, typically connecting through major cities like New York or San Francisco before landing at Reno-Tahoe International Airport (RNO). For those coming from Manchester or Edinburgh, flight times will be similar, but it's best to check for the most efficient connections when planning your journey.
Best time to visit Reno
Reno experiences a high desert climate that offers diverse seasonal experiences. The summer months, particularly from June to August, see average temperatures range between 25°C and 33°C, creating the perfect environment for outdoor activities like hiking and biking. In contrast, winter (December to February) can be quite chilly, with temperatures dropping to around -2°C to 8°C. Snow enthusiasts will find this season ideal for skiing around Lake Tahoe, which is just a short drive away. Spring and autumn are also delightful, with mild temperatures typically between 10°C and 25°C, making it an excellent time for sightseeing and enjoying local events.
